Navigating the L1 Visa Refine in Delhi: Your Comprehensive Overview to Success Charting the L1 visa procedure in Delhi can be a complicated endeavor, demanding a clear understanding of the different eligibility needs and paperwork needed for a successful application. With distinct categories for managers and specialized knowledge workers, applicants https://garrettabahn.ja-blog.com/37409844/l1-visa-success-stories-professionals-who-made-it